Snowboarding is not just a sport that requires you to glide on ice. It is a sport that entails both physical and mental skill. Other than that, it makes the cold tolerable and winter fun. It offers a number of benefits to its enthusiasts. Basically, it promotes an exciting rush of happiness. Gliding on the mountains of snow will give that floating feeling coupled with a fun sort-of flying experience. Also, for every learned task and every successful trick, you get to experience a great sense of fulfillment. Thus, you get to boost your self-esteem.

Snowboarding is an enjoyable sport itself, and you can get the most fun out of
it with the following tips:

Switch your style

Are you doing the same style over and over again? Better spice up your style, and enjoy the snow on a different level. You can first start either with a simple gliding or a few fancy tricks. You can even try a new slope as long as it is safe for you ability level. Also, you can try new snow board rentals which offer both demo and performance snowboards.

Do what children do

Children seem to have the most fun when it comes to snowboarding. So, why not enjoy what they are enjoying? It might seem a bit immature, but there is definitely more fun to be had when you try one of the terrain parks. Another idea, is to try a kid-sized snow board and learn several new tricks with it. You can even teach some kids while you are at it.

Learn a new trick

Nothing is as exciting as making a new move or getting to learn new tricks. If you find your usual moves dull, you can ask someone to teach you new tricks or, better yet, discover them on your own.

Make a video

If you are fond of watching professional snowboarders on their videos, then you too can make one. You can have a sport camera placed on your helmet or goggles, or you can have someone video your snowboard trick. You can then upload and make a collection of your videos.

Try new terrain

If you haven’t experienced all the snowboard terrain, then you better try it all! You can improve your moves and learn special tricks in snowboarding terrain parks that have half pipes.

Snowboarding is undeniably fun, but a few problems may come your way. There could be grey skies and flat light, very low temperatures, snow blizzards, or accidents. Therefore, you should mindful of safety equipment and make sure to use proper clothing and accessories. So, be safe and have fun!
